TPWallet 以太坊钱包:隐私保护、合约交互与硬件协同的全景式分析

以下分析聚焦“TPWallet里的以太坊钱包”(以太坊地址、ERC-20/721交互、以及在TP生态中完成转账/授权/交易的能力),从隐私保护、全球化智能支付系统、高级风险控制、全球化技术进步、合约交互、硬件钱包协同六个维度展开。由于不同版本与链上/链下策略会随时间演进,本文以通用机制与常见实现思路为主,供你建立系统性判断框架。

一、隐私保护:从“链上可见性”到“用户可控性”

1)链上透明的边界与真实风险

以太坊的基础特性决定:转账与合约交互会在链上产生可追踪的记录。即便TPWallet提供良好交互体验,链上地址与交易数据仍可能被分析工具关联到用户身份或资金流向。

因此,“隐私保护”在工程上更多体现为:减少不必要泄露、降低可关联性、提升用户对授权与数据披露的控制。

2)地址与交易层面的可控策略

- 最小化授权:只对必要的合约/额度进行授权,避免长期无限额度授权导致资产暴露。

- 合理的地址使用习惯:减少长期复用同一地址;在支持的情况下,使用更细粒度的钱包/地址管理策略降低关联性。

- 选择更合适的交互路径:例如尽量避免多余中转、避免一次性把多个目的资金打包进同一复杂交易流程(复杂性可能带来更难解释的链上关联)。

3)数据管理与本地安全

移动端钱包通常把私钥/签名材料尽量保存在本地;在你没有开启不必要的同步、备份或云端可见能力时,个人敏感信息的泄露面会更小。

此外,良好的隐私保护往往也包含:

- 交易确认前的风险提示(例如授权、合约权限、潜在恶意合约)。

- 对可疑DApp/路由的拦截或降权(例如提醒“非官方来源”、验证合约基本信息)。

4)“隐私≠匿名”的合规认知

即便采取了更少信息披露的操作,链上仍可通过时间戳、金额、交易图谱进行关联分析。更准确的目标应是:让用户把“可被关联的程度”控制到可接受范围,并避免因授权或交互失误造成可观的隐私损失与资产风险。

二、全球化智能支付系统:从“跨网络可用”到“跨场景可落地”

1)支付系统的核心能力

全球化智能支付通常关注:

- 多链/多资产覆盖:用户在不同链上处理资产,钱包需要能识别并完成对应签名与交易构造。

- 价格与流动性路由:在链上兑换或转账时,路由选择影响滑点、手续费与到账速度。

- 交易体验:统一的地址识别、资产展示、费率估算与失败回滚提示。

2)以太坊钱包在“全球化支付”中的角色

以太坊在全球生态中的流通性强,但Gas波动与网络拥堵会影响支付体验。TPWallet的价值在于把复杂度封装:

- 自动/半自动费率与Gas建议(由钱包或聚合器进行估计)。

- 支持主流标准(ERC-20、NFT)与合约交互,让“转账、兑换、质押、领取”能在同一界面完成。

3)跨时区与跨地区可用性

全球化意味着:用户来自不同国家地区,对语言、时区、支付/手续费认知差异显著。良好的钱包通常会提供:

- 本地化提示:减少误操作。

- 明确的确认流程:尤其是授权、合约调用、代币批准等关键步骤。

三、高级风险控制:把“用户易错点”前移

高级风险控制并不只是“事后风控”,而是尽量在签名前把风险识别出来。

1)授权风险(Approval/Rug Vector)

- 无限授权是常见高风险来源:一旦授权给恶意合约或发生合约漏洞,资产可能被转走。

- 风控方向:

- 默认避免无限授权,或在需要时强提示。

- 在授权界面展示:合约名称/地址、额度、可能的权限范围。

2)合约交互风险

合约交互不仅有“交换/转账”这种常规操作,还包含:路由器、代理合约、聚合器调用。风险通常来自:

- 合约地址冒用、仿冒DApp。

- 交易参数异常(金额为0、路径异常、路由不可达)。

3)交易构造与撤销能力

- 对失败交易给出清晰原因:例如Gas不足、合约回退原因、滑点过高导致失败。

- 逐步降低“不可逆错误”:在签名前二次确认关键参数。

- 提供撤销授权(Revoke)入口:降低授权后长期暴露。

4)可疑行为与系统提示

- 风险评分/白名单策略:对常见DEX路由器、知名合约进行更强的校验。

- 对高额授权或多跳交换给出额外确认。

四、全球化技术进步:让“钱包”具备可扩展能力

1)跨链与可扩展架构

全球用户对资产和网络的选择越来越多样:以太坊主网、Layer2、以及其他链并行存在。钱包要保持可扩展性:

- 统一的签名与地址管理抽象。

- 对不同链的Gas模型、交易格式、确认机制适配。

2)聚合器与路由的演进

智能支付的体验依赖路由器与聚合器能力:

- 更准确的报价与更好的滑点控制。

- 支持更丰富的交易类型(兑换、批量处理、跨协议路由)。

3)安全技术的持续升级

技术进步往往体现为:

- 更强的钓鱼检测与合约识别。

- 更精细的权限解析(把“合约做什么”翻译成用户可理解语言)。

- 提升交易广播与失败处理能力,降低因链上拥堵造成的资产与体验损失。

五、合约交互:以太坊钱包的“高频操作面”

合约交互通常包括:

- ERC-20转账(本质是调用transfer函数)。

- 代币批准(approve/permit)。

- DEX交换(调用路由器/交换器合约)。

- NFT交互(ERC-721/1155的mint/transfer/approval)。

- 质押/借贷/收益类合约。

1)交互流程的关键节点

- 准备:钱包解析合约ABI、填充参数。

- 估算:估算Gas并估算失败概率(回退原因、滑点风险)。

- 签名:用户签名交易数据。

- 广播与确认:等待链上确认并刷新余额/交易状态。

2)ABI与参数风险

合约交互的“参数正确性”极关键:

- 金额单位与小数精度(ERC-20 decimals)。

- 路径/路由参数是否被恶意DApp篡改。

- 接收地址/代币合约地址是否与预期一致。

3)授权与合约权限的理解

很多资产丢失并非直接转错,而是授权后合约获得转走权限。建议你在每次授权时理解:

- 授权给谁(合约地址)。

- 授权额度到哪里(额度、是否无限)。

- 是否需要长期授权,能否用“仅需一次/有限额度”的方式替代。

六、硬件钱包:与TPWallet协同的“冷签名”护城河

1)硬件钱包的意义

硬件钱包本质是把私钥隔离在离线设备中,由设备完成签名。对抗的主要威胁包括:

- 恶意软件窃取私钥。

- 热钱包环境被入侵导致的签名篡改。

2)协同方式(常见逻辑)

当TPWallet支持硬件钱包时,通常会出现以下协同链路:

- 钱包软件负责:展示交易详情、构建交易、请求签名。

- 硬件设备负责:显示并确认交易要签名的关键字段,然后在本地签名。

- 用户在硬件设备上确认后,签名结果回传,软件再广播到链上。

3)你需要特别核对的“硬件确认要点”

- to 地址/合约地址是否正确。

- token 合约地址与金额是否正确。

- 授权额度是否异常(例如你并不打算无限授权)。

- 网络与链ID是否正确(避免跨链误签)。

4)硬件钱包并非万能

硬件钱包能大幅降低私钥泄露风险,但仍需要:

- 你确认的“交易内容”必须准确。

- 仍要警惕恶意DApp引导你签署恶意合约交互或授权。

因此,风险控制与信息核对仍然重要。

结语:用“六维框架”做持续评估

把TPWallet里的以太坊钱包看作一个系统:

- 隐私保护:在透明链上尽量减少不必要关联与授权泄露。

- 全球化智能支付:通过路由、费率、体验优化让跨地区交易更可落地。

- 高级风险控制:前置识别授权与合约参数风险,并提供撤销与清晰提示。

- 全球化技术进步:通过可扩展架构与安全升级持续适配多网络与多资产。

- 合约交互:重点在ABI参数正确性与权限理解。

- 硬件钱包:用冷签名把私钥风险隔离,但仍要核对交易内容。

如果你愿意,我也可以按你的使用场景(例如:只做转账/常用DEX兑换/参与质押借贷/持有NFT)给出“以太坊钱包操作清单”和“授权/合约交互检查表”。

作者:随机作者名发布时间:2026-05-06 12:18:26

评论

LinguaZed

分析很到位,尤其是把“隐私≠匿名”和授权风险讲清楚了。

萌猫不睡觉

硬件钱包协同那段我看懂了:关键是核对合约地址和授权额度,而不是只相信界面。

ByteWanderer

全球化智能支付的思路不错,Gas波动与路由选择对体验影响被点出来了。

AstraDragon

合约交互流程拆得很清楚,参数正确性和decimals的小坑提醒很实用。

SakuraKiwi

喜欢这种六维框架式总结,能直接拿来做检查清单。

相关阅读
<time lang="336hl6"></time><ins date-time="ye8x3h"></ins><var lang="_1s25q"></var><i dir="16h2mi"></i><kbd date-time="ll6kvr"></kbd><ins lang="mx9jcu"></ins><noscript dropzone="n7yona"></noscript>